Office of Computing Services Newsletters

 Collection
Identifier: AS36.T4 C64
Abstract Newsletter put out by the Office of Computing Services on a monthly, and later once per semester, basis. Beginning in 1975, it provided important information about personnel changes, computer and memory acquisitions, guidelines for running computer programs, training sessions, and general administration information, such as lab hours and the computer center directory. The title changed over the years, and it has been known as the Computer Center Newsletter, the Computing Services Newsletter,...
Dates: 1978-1997, undated

Oscar Strahan photographs and papers

 Collection
Identifier: 90.200-Faculty-2016-Strahan
Abstract

Oscar Strahan served as the first professional coach and first Athletic Director for Southwest Texas State (now Texas State University) from 1919 to 1961. Largely photographs, the collection contains noteworthy images of early Southwest Texas State Normal College sports teams, World War I training camp Camp Logan, and mass produced battlefield views from France. Also includes Strahan’s family history materials.

Dates: circa 1860s - 1980s

Panther Hall Collection

 Collection
Identifier: SWWC-093
Abstract

Panther Hall was a concert hall located in Fort Worth, Texas and open from 1963-1978. The collection contains mostly photographs documenting the various artists that performed at the concert hall. Some of these musical artists include Waylon Jennings, Tanya Tucker, Tammy Wynette, Willie Nelson, Fats Domino, Jerry Lee Lewis, Tony Douglas, Loretta Lynn, and Conway Twitty. In addition to the photographs, the collection also contains promotional materials, papers, and published materials.

Dates: 1963-1987

Pennington Funeral Home ledgers

 Collection
Identifier: 100.100-Pennington
Abstract

Pennington Funeral Home is a family-owned business in San Marcos, Texas. This collection consist of business records, including one cemetery ledger (1888-1900) and multiple funeral registers dating from 1902 to the mid-1940s that detail deaths in the Hays County and San Marcos, Texas area.

Dates: 1888-1944
